## **China Composite Repair Market Drivers**

### Growing Infrastructure Development in China

China is experiencing robust infrastructure development driven by government initiatives aimed at urbanization and modernization. The Chinese government has allocated substantial budgets for infrastructure projects, such as highways, bridges, and public transportation systems. Reports indicate that from 2020 to 2025, infrastructure spending is likely to exceed USD 5 trillion, with a significant portion dedicated to enhancing the durability and performance of materials used in construction.This growth fuels the demand for advanced composites, which require repair solutions to sustain longevity.

The China Composite Repair Market Industry stands to benefit as manufacturers upgrade existing infrastructures to meet modern standards while ensuring cost efficiency. Additionally, organizations like the Ministry of Transport of the People's Republic of China emphasize the necessity for quality repairs to maintain safety and operational efficiency, effectively aligning with the objectives of the composite repair market.

### Increasing Adoption of Advanced Composites in Various Industries

The increasing integration of advanced composites across multiple sectors, including aerospace, automotive, and wind energy, is significantly propelling the demand for composite repair solutions in China. The Chinese aerospace sector, for example, has been making strides, expecting to see a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 7% from 2021 to 2025.

Companies such as Commercial Aircraft Corporation of China (COMAC) are leading this transformation, as they incorporate composite materials in aircraft design for lightweight and fuel efficiency, which inevitably require effective repair options.The rise in the use of such materials necessitates repair technologies that can extend the lifecycle and performance of composites, thereby stimulating growth in the China Composite Repair Market Industry.

### **China Composite Repair Market Industry Developments**

Recent developments in the China Composite Repair Market have been significant, particularly with the growth of companies like AVIC Aircraft and China National Offshore Oil Corporation, which are enhancing their capabilities in composite materials for aircraft and marine applications. As of August 2023, China Eastern Airlines announced an initiative to expand their fleet maintenance using advanced composite repair techniques, indicating a shift towards more efficient repair methods in the aviation sector. In September 2023, COMAC secured a partnership with Sinoma International Engineering to manufacture composite components for commercial aircraft, further solidifying the industry's move into high-performance materials.

Additionally, in July 2023, a merger was announced between China State Shipbuilding Corporation and a subsidiary focused on composite repairs, aiming to innovate ship maintenance processes. Notably, growth in market valuation is reported among companies like China National Petroleum Corporation and Sinopec Limited, reflecting increased investments in technology for composite repairs, particularly within the energy sector. Over the past two years, the emphasis on research and development in composite materials has been evident, with substantial government support aiming to reach self-sufficiency in advanced composites by 2024.

## Competitive Benchmarking

The composite repair market in China is characterized by a dynamic competitive landscape, driven by increasing demand for lightweight materials and advanced repair solutions across various industries, including aerospace, automotive, and construction. Key players such as [Hexcel Corporation](https://www.hexcel.com/Markets/Commercial-Aerospace/compositerepair) (US), Solvay SA (BE), and Toray Industries Inc (JP) are strategically positioned to leverage their technological expertise and innovation capabilities. These companies focus on enhancing their product offerings through research and development, while also pursuing strategic partnerships to expand their market reach. The collective strategies of these firms contribute to a moderately fragmented market structure, where competition is intensifying as companies seek to differentiate themselves through advanced composite solutions.In terms of business tactics, companies are increasingly localizing manufacturing to reduce lead times and optimize supply chains. This approach not only enhances operational efficiency but also aligns with the growing trend of sustainability, as local production minimizes transportation emissions. The competitive structure of the market appears to be moderately fragmented, with several key players exerting influence over market dynamics. The presence of both multinational corporations and local firms creates a diverse competitive environment, fostering innovation and collaboration.

In October Hexcel Corporation (US) announced a strategic partnership with a leading Chinese aerospace manufacturer to develop advanced composite materials tailored for the aviation sector. This collaboration is expected to enhance Hexcel's position in the rapidly growing aerospace market in China, allowing for the integration of cutting-edge technologies and materials that meet the specific needs of local manufacturers. The strategic importance of this partnership lies in its potential to accelerate product development cycles and improve market responsiveness.

In September Solvay SA (BE) launched a new line of eco-friendly composite repair solutions aimed at the automotive sector. This initiative reflects Solvay's commitment to sustainability and innovation, as the company seeks to address the increasing demand for environmentally responsible products. The introduction of these solutions is likely to strengthen Solvay's competitive edge by appealing to manufacturers focused on reducing their carbon footprint and enhancing the recyclability of their products.

In August Toray Industries Inc (JP) expanded its production capacity for composite materials in China, investing approximately €50 million in a new facility. This expansion is indicative of Toray's long-term strategy to capitalize on the growing demand for composite materials in various industries. By increasing production capacity, Toray aims to enhance its supply chain reliability and meet the rising needs of its customers, thereby solidifying its market position.
